About The Position

The Pharmacy Technician II is responsible for assisting the pharmacist in dispensing and filling prescriptions. The Pharmacy Technician duties include, but are not limited to, entering prescriptions in the computer, filing prescriptions, ordering medications and over the counter items, calling third party insurance providers, and aiding the pharmacist in the day-to-day operations. The Pharmacy Technician II is also responsible for checking in orders, putting orders away (OTC, and RX), and completing end of day closing and deposit procedures.

Responsibilities

  • Prepares, fills and labels medications for final dispensing authorization by the Pharmacists.
  • Prepares the unit dose accurately according to the refill list, for Pharmacists final authorization and fill the automated medication station in timely manner.
  • Conducts rounds to nursing units according to schedule and prepares medications for transportation rounds.
  • Performs various pharmacy-related tasks to help maintain pharmacy efficiency and organization.
  • Assist in maintenance of pharmacy inventory of supplies and medications, (RX and OTC)
